From a9770c4b6c9fb80ae1b33f5e901ed0a5e5bfb25c Mon Sep 17 00:00:00 2001 From: Stephen Kelly Date: Tue, 10 Sep 2013 09:19:35 +0200 Subject: Remove some unneeded constructors. Change-Id: I34f86960dc0cfaada509957bca5466b2765e8239 Reviewed-by: Olivier Goffart --- src/corelib/kernel/qmetatype.h | 14 +++----------- 1 file changed, 3 insertions(+), 11 deletions(-) (limited to 'src') diff --git a/src/corelib/kernel/qmetatype.h b/src/corelib/kernel/qmetatype.h index 0c8f273887..0b8be3af89 100644 --- a/src/corelib/kernel/qmetatype.h +++ b/src/corelib/kernel/qmetatype.h @@ -995,8 +995,6 @@ public: template struct QSequentialIterableConvertFunctor { - QSequentialIterableConvertFunctor() {} - QSequentialIterableImpl operator()(const From &f) const { return QSequentialIterableImpl(&f); @@ -1162,8 +1160,6 @@ public: template struct QAssociativeIterableConvertFunctor { - QAssociativeIterableConvertFunctor() {} - QAssociativeIterableImpl operator()(const From& f) const { return QAssociativeIterableImpl(&f); @@ -1219,8 +1215,6 @@ struct QPairVariantInterfaceConvertFunctor; template struct QPairVariantInterfaceConvertFunctor > { - QPairVariantInterfaceConvertFunctor() {} - QPairVariantInterfaceImpl operator()(const QPair& f) const { return QPairVariantInterfaceImpl(&f); @@ -1230,8 +1224,6 @@ struct QPairVariantInterfaceConvertFunctor > template struct QPairVariantInterfaceConvertFunctor > { - QPairVariantInterfaceConvertFunctor() {} - QPairVariantInterfaceImpl operator()(const std::pair& f) const { return QPairVariantInterfaceImpl(&f); @@ -2014,7 +2006,7 @@ inline bool QtPrivate::IsMetaTypePair::registerConverter(int id) { const int toId = qMetaTypeId(); if (!QMetaType::hasRegisteredConverterFunction(id, toId)) { - static const QtMetaTypePrivate::QPairVariantInterfaceConvertFunctor o; + QtMetaTypePrivate::QPairVariantInterfaceConvertFunctor o; static const QtPrivate::ConverterFunctor > f(o); @@ -2031,7 +2023,7 @@ namespace QtPrivate { { const int toId = qMetaTypeId(); if (!QMetaType::hasRegisteredConverterFunction(id, toId)) { - static const QtMetaTypePrivate::QSequentialIterableConvertFunctor o; + QtMetaTypePrivate::QSequentialIterableConvertFunctor o; static const QtPrivate::ConverterFunctor > f(o); @@ -2048,7 +2040,7 @@ namespace QtPrivate { { const int toId = qMetaTypeId(); if (!QMetaType::hasRegisteredConverterFunction(id, toId)) { - static const QtMetaTypePrivate::QAssociativeIterableConvertFunctor o; + QtMetaTypePrivate::QAssociativeIterableConvertFunctor o; static const QtPrivate::ConverterFunctor > f(o); -- cgit v1.2.3